Why Visit Shimane for this Experience?

Shimane Prefecture, often overlooked by mainstream tourism, is a hidden gem with a rich cultural heritage and breathtaking natural beauty. This makes it the perfect setting for an immersive cinematic experience.

  • Authentic Japanese Culture: Beyond the “Silver Screen Fan” attraction, Shimane offers a chance to experience traditional Japanese life. Visit the awe-inspiring Izumo Taisha Grand Shrine, one of Japan’s oldest and most important Shinto shrines. Wander through the charming streets of Tsuwano, a historic castle town with beautifully preserved samurai residences.
  • Stunning Scenery: From the dramatic coastline of the Sea of Japan to the lush mountains and tranquil lakes, Shimane boasts a diverse landscape that will captivate your senses. Imagine exploring the rugged Oki Islands, a UNESCO Global Geopark, or relaxing on the pristine beaches of the Izumo coast.
  • Tranquility and Peace: Away from the crowds of Tokyo and Kyoto, Shimane offers a welcome escape from the hustle and bustle of modern life. You can truly unwind and immerse yourself in the beauty and serenity of the region.
  • Foodie Delights: Shimane is known for its fresh seafood, including crab, oysters, and sea bream. Be sure to try the local sake and sample the regional specialties, such as izumo soba noodles.
